We have a unique opportunity to join a landmark clean-water infrastructure scheme that also involves significant highway and access infrastructure works to support the permanent scheme and temporary construction logistics. This presents a significant opportunity to deliver highway construction within a nationally significant infrastructure programme under a Tier 1 design-and-build contractor.As a Highways Construction Manager, you will lead the planning, delivery and completion of packages of the highway and road infrastructure works associated with the scheme. You will manage multi-disciplinary teams, ensure safe, efficient delivery on time and budget, and interface with stakeholders, including highways authorities, utility providers, designers and delivery teams.
Key Responsibilities
Lead the construction phase of highway packages, including but not limited to access junctions, road widening, passing bays, road upgrades, temporary bridges and temporary haul roads.
Develop and manage the construction programme for the responsible highway package.
Take responsibility for cost control, forecasting and profitability of the highways scope.
